0

これが現在実行しているもので、ドメイン モードの JBoss 7.1.1 です。OS Red Hat:Red Hat Enterprise Linux Server リリース 6.4 (サンティアゴ)

したがって、ドメイン コントローラーとして機能するホスト (Host-A) には、App-Server もあります。他に 17 のホストがありますが、現在 Host-A でテストしています。

そのサーバーの domain.xml でカスタム プロファイルを作成し、そのプロファイルで次のようなログの場所を構成しました。

<profile name="AppLogix-full-ha">
            <subsystem xmlns="urn:jboss:domain:logging:1.1">
                <console-handler name="CONSOLE">
                    <level name="INFO"/>
                    <formatter>
                        <pattern-formatter pattern="%d{HH:mm:ss,SSS} %-5p [%c] (%t) %s%E%n"/>
                    </formatter>
                </console-handler>
                <periodic-rotating-file-handler name="FILE">
                    <level name="INFO"/>
                    <formatter>
                        <pattern-formatter pattern="%d{HH:mm:ss,SSS} %-5p [%c] (%t) %s%E%n"/>
                    </formatter>
                   <file relative-to="jboss.server.log.dir" path="/apps/logs/AppLogix.Cluster/server.log"/>
                    <suffix value=".yyyy-MM-dd"/>
                    <append value="true"/>
                </periodic-rotating-file-handler>

これは、アプリ サーバー用にログが構成されている唯一の場所です。Host-A の host.xml には何もありません。

問題は、/apps/jboss/jboss-as-7.1.1.Final/domain/servers/AppLogix.Member1/log (これがデフォルトの場所だと思います) にログを作成し続けることです。

ここで専門家が間違っていることは何ですか? 私は何を取りこぼしたか?どんな助けも非常に高く評価されています。KKさん、よろしくお願いします。

4

2 に答える 2

0

OK わかりました....domain.xml の最後で間違ったプロファイルを使用していました........OK domain.xml の下部でそれを見つけました すべてのプロファイルにserver.log ファイルの正しい場所ですが、まだデフォルトの場所を指している full-ha (未使用の役に立たないプロファイル) と呼ばれる別のプロファイルがありました。full-ha から適切なプロファイル名に変更するのを忘れていました。一度変更すると、すべて正常に機能しました!!!

于 2013-09-27T16:36:10.690 に答える